[management] Fix session inactivity response (#2770)

This commit is contained in:
pascal-fischer 2024-10-23 16:40:15 +02:00 committed by GitHub
parent 7bda385e1b
commit 563dca705c
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194

View File

@ -137,13 +137,15 @@ func toAccountResponse(accountID string, settings *server.Settings) *api.Account
} }
apiSettings := api.AccountSettings{ apiSettings := api.AccountSettings{
PeerLoginExpiration: int(settings.PeerLoginExpiration.Seconds()), PeerLoginExpiration: int(settings.PeerLoginExpiration.Seconds()),
PeerLoginExpirationEnabled: settings.PeerLoginExpirationEnabled, PeerLoginExpirationEnabled: settings.PeerLoginExpirationEnabled,
GroupsPropagationEnabled: &settings.GroupsPropagationEnabled, PeerInactivityExpiration: int(settings.PeerInactivityExpiration.Seconds()),
JwtGroupsEnabled: &settings.JWTGroupsEnabled, PeerInactivityExpirationEnabled: settings.PeerInactivityExpirationEnabled,
JwtGroupsClaimName: &settings.JWTGroupsClaimName, GroupsPropagationEnabled: &settings.GroupsPropagationEnabled,
JwtAllowGroups: &jwtAllowGroups, JwtGroupsEnabled: &settings.JWTGroupsEnabled,
RegularUsersViewBlocked: settings.RegularUsersViewBlocked, JwtGroupsClaimName: &settings.JWTGroupsClaimName,
JwtAllowGroups: &jwtAllowGroups,
RegularUsersViewBlocked: settings.RegularUsersViewBlocked,
} }
if settings.Extra != nil { if settings.Extra != nil {